1. Understand the Hidden Traps of Fast Food
Fast food isn't just about calories; it's about what those calories are made of. Often, these meals are loaded with unhealthy fats, excessive sodium, refined sugars, and artificial additives. These ingredients can trigger cravings, lead to inflammation, and disrupt your body's natural hunger and satiety signals, making weight loss an uphill battle. 2. Prioritize Nutrient-Dense Alternatives
Instead of reaching for a greasy burger, think about the incredible variety of fresh, wholesome ingredients available right here in the UAE. Our local markets and supermarkets are brimming with vibrant fruits, crisp v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y grains. Opt for a grilled chicken salad, a hearty lentil soup (adas), or a delicious wrap filled with hummus and fresh veggies. These choices provide sustained energy and essential nutrients, a cornerstone of "healthy eating."
3. Master the Art of Meal Prep for Busy Schedules
One of the biggest reasons people turn to fast food is convenience. In Dubai's fast-paced environment, this is understandable. The solution? Meal prepping! Dedicate a few hours on your weekend to prepare healthy meals and snacks for the week ahead. Think overnight oats for breakfast, pre-chopped salads for lunch, and pre-portioned lean protein with roasted vegetables for dinner. 4. Embrace Local Flavors and Healthy Middle Eastern Cuisine
The beauty of Middle Eastern cuisine is its inherent healthfulness when prepared traditionally. Dishes like grilled kebabs, tabbouleh, fattoush, and various lentil and chickpea-based meals are naturally rich in protein, fiber, and healthy fats. Explore these delicious options rather than processed fast food. Many local restaurants offer fantastic grilled and baked choices that fit perfectly into your "healthy eating" plan.
5. Hydrate Smart: Ditch Sugary Drinks
Fast food often comes with sugary sodas, which are empty calories that sabotage your weight loss efforts. In our warm UAE climate, staying hydrated is crucial. Make water your primary beverage. Infuse it with cucumber, mint, or lemon for a refreshing twist. Unsweetened green tea or karak (in moderation) can also be excellent choices. 6. Plan Ahead for Dining Out
Socializing over food is a big part of life in Dubai. You don't have to avoid restaurants entirely! Before heading out, quickly check the menu online. Look for grilled, baked, or steamed options. Don't be afraid to ask for modifications, like dressing on the side or extra vegetables instead of fries. 9. Be Mindful of Cravings, Don't Suppress Them
Cravings are normal. Instead of fighting them, try to understand them. Are you truly hungry, or are you bored, stressed, or thirsty? If it's a genuine craving for something specific, try to find a healthier alternative. A piece of fruit instead of candy, or a small handful of nuts instead of chips.
